Can you search a number plate in South Africa?

Yes, a South African number plate can be used to check vehicle specification details. With VerifyNow, the lookup is designed for businesses that need to confirm whether a vehicle's basic details make sense before they continue with onboarding, a sale, a rental, an insurance workflow or a fraud-prevention review.

The important point is scope: this is a vehicle specification lookup, not a private-owner search. It helps you confirm the vehicle, not expose personal information about a person.

What you can check with VerifyNow

VerifyNow vehicle lookup can help confirm core vehicle details linked to a number plate or VIN, including:

  • Make
  • Model
  • Model year
  • VIN / vehicle identification number
  • Technical specification details where available

That is the information most teams need for the first question: "Does the vehicle being presented match the details on record?"

For example, if a customer gives you a registration number for a Toyota Hilux but the returned details point to a different make, model or year, that is a signal to pause and ask for corrected documents before the transaction moves further.

What the result helps you decide

A number plate search is most useful when you are trying to reduce obvious vehicle-data risk. It can help you answer questions like:

  • Does this number plate return the expected vehicle make and model?
  • Does the VIN match what the customer or seller supplied?
  • Is the year or specification different from the advertised vehicle?
  • Should the team continue the workflow or ask for better documentation?

The result gives your team a practical checkpoint. It is not meant to replace every other due-diligence step, but it can stop a weak or mismatched vehicle record from slipping through unnoticed.

What it does not show

VerifyNow keeps this lookup limited to vehicle specification data. It does not return:

  • The registered owner's name
  • The owner's ID number, address or contact details
  • Outstanding finance status
  • Stolen-vehicle or police-interest status
  • Licence-disc validity or expiry
  • Ownership transfer history

That limitation is a strength for normal business verification. You get the vehicle facts needed for the workflow without turning a number plate check into a personal-information search.
